Mansfield College Chapel

Founded in 1838 for Nonconformist students, Mansfield College moved to Oxford in 1886, becoming a notable part of the university’s landscape.

Its architecture reflects a combination of traditional and modern styles, with facilities that include quaint student accommodations and a serene garden. Historical significance includes its royal charter in 1995, granting it full college status, and its role in promoting inclusive education.

Noteworthy Features

🕍 Historical Chapel: The chapel's design emphasizes simplicity and purpose.
🍽️ College Crypt: Enjoy a full English or continental breakfast in the cozy Crypt.
🌳 Tranquil Gardens: Ideal for quiet reflection or study.

Mansfield College Chapel is free to visit and is particularly suited for tourists, history enthusiasts, and those seeking a peaceful retreat.

Founder History

Established in Birmingham, it moved to Oxford in 1886, emphasizing education for Nonconformists.

Royal Charter

Awarded full college status in 1995, enhancing its educational credibility.

Diverse Community

Hosts 231 undergraduates, 158 graduates, and 67 fellows as of 2018.
